113,455,766,151,000 is an even composite number composed of seven prime numbers multiplied together.

What does the number 113455766151000 look like?

This visualization shows the relationship between its 7 prime factors (large circles) and 2304 divisors.

113455766151000 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two thousand, three hundred four divisors.

Prime factorization of 113455766151000:

23 × 35 × 53 × 72 × 13 × 421 × 1741

(2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 7 × 7 × 13 × 421 × 1741)
